Coulter McMahen is the President and CEO of the Louisiana Automobile Dealers Association (LADA). McMahen represents dealers before legislative and regulatory bodies and key decision-makers, steers LADA's strategic direction, and fosters a collaborative community among dealers statewide. McMahen also serves as Administrator for the Louisiana Automobile Dealers Self Insurers’ Fund (LADA-SIF), LADA's exclusive workers’ compensation insurer, operated by and for dealers, which has returned over $105 million in member distributions since its inception.
Before assuming these roles, McMahen forged his path as a formidable commercial litigation attorney at Taylor, Porter, Brooks & Phillips LLP, where he advocated for businesses across the nation. His contributions were duly recognized, earning him the distinction of being named a finalist for The Frank L. Maraist Young Lawyer of the Year Award by the Louisiana Association of Defense Counsel. McMahen began his legal career as a judicial law clerk for the Honorable S. Maurice Hicks, Jr., in the United States District Court for the Western District of Louisiana. McMahen earned a Bachelor of Science (B.S.) in Finance and a Juris Doctor (J.D.) from Louisiana State University.
